Could electronic conveyancing help the housing crisis?

Electronic conveyancing could cut the time taken to buy a home to as little as four weeks.

Secure, paperless and electronic conveyancing processes would save costs, cut red tape and reduce stress of house sales.

Right now, it can take up to 6 months, sometimes even more to buy and own a house.

Joining Seán to discuss is Mike Stack, a Solicitor with digital conveyancing specialists Beam.
